Jon's Current Read

Storey Park Ph 3 Prcl K is a new-construction pocket of Orlando's larger Storey Park development, with homes built between 2021 and 2024 and a median year built of 2023. At a median of $490,000 and roughly $199.52 per square foot on a typical home near 2,199 square feet, pricing here tracks closely with build quality and finish level rather than lot size or age variation, since nearly every home in the data set is under five years old.

A median 100 days on market is long for a newer-construction community and signals buyers are taking their time, likely comparing this parcel against new inventory elsewhere in Storey Park or nearby Orlando developments. For sellers, that points to pricing precisely at market rather than testing the top. For buyers, it means there is room to negotiate and less urgency to move on the first showing.

A young, still-settling micro-market

With 262 homes and a median year built of 2023, this parcel is still working through its first ownership cycle. A homestead share of 45.8% suggests a meaningful portion of homes are not filed as a primary residence in Orange County records, which is common in newer communities where investor purchases, second homes, and recent move-ins (before a homestead exemption is filed) are more prevalent than in established neighborhoods.

No community amenities are identified in current MLS listings for this specific parcel, which does not necessarily mean none exist, but it does mean buyers should verify directly what, if anything, is included via HOA or shared with the broader Storey Park development rather than assuming resort-style features are part of the package here.
